Ana Carrasco impresses with seventh place on the grid, Vinales to start Australian GP from fourth

 In Moto3, News

CarrascoIt’s been a great day of qualifying for Team Calvo in Phillip Island where Maverick Viñales and Ana Carrasco were doing well on their KTMs. Viñales, who was fastest in the morning session, couldn’t repeat his laptime from FP3 which was two tenth faster than pole position. But although he finished the day in fourth, the young Spaniard stays calm, because he has a good pace for the race and will be aiming for victory.

Ana Carrasco once again might history with the best qualifying result for a Spanish female ride in the world championship. Her adaptation to the Australian circuit went perfectly and she finished only six tenth behind pole position. Tomorrow she will start from seventh and her goal will be to stick with and learn from the fastest riders.

Maverick Viñales #25 – 4º – 1’37”361 “It’s not been the best qualifying, but first of all I want to congratulate Ana, because we did two laps together and she was fast. This morning we had a bit more acceleration and speed than in the qualifying and there’s only small gaps here. But we’re very happy, because we have a great bike and can do a ’37 pace which for me is the most important. Starting from first or second row doesn’t make much difference for me. I think tomorrow we can serve a big surprise and fight for victory.”

Ana Carrasco #22 – 7ª – 1’37”544 “I am very happy, because this is my best qualifying of the season and in general the weekend has been the same. We are working very well and the bike is setup perfectly. In the qualifying we had not the best strategy, so I am superhappy with this 7th place. I did the laptimes very easily and I felt very comfortable. The race will be very difficult, because I am not familiar with the guys I have in front. I’ll try to do my best and finish as far ahead as possible.”
